Backed by Neuroscience
Neuroscientists have studied brain scans and MRIs to learn that repetitive thoughts form neural pathways. In these pathways, neurons are fired together and thus become wired together. Put simply, the more one thought or belief is reinforced, the stronger these neural pathways become. Similar to the same route you take to work or the same path you navigate in the grocery store, these thoughts become automatic and become the habit of our thinking pattern.
Neuroscientists have also coined the term “neuroplasticity” to refer to our brain’s ability to rewire these neural pathways. Our minds have the agility to change, which is expressed and reflected in our points of view. With the flexibility to change our neural pathways, we can essentially change our thinking and thoughts, thus also changing our life experiences.
